
Have you ever thought reward-based dog training just doesn’t work for YOUR dog?
A lot of people do! The thing to realize is: motivation can be complicated, and “rewards” are not always what you intended them to be.
If you call your dog away from playing with a friend, “reward” him with a treat, then leash him up and put him in the car… was he rewarded by the treat? Or punished by the end of playtime?
Likely a little of both. And you might notice which was more meaningful to him next time you try to call him away from playing with a friend and he ignores you!
This doesn’t mean reward-based dog training doesn’t work. It means you accidentally punished the behavior you meant to reward.
